Facebook Ads CPC Increase
What is the reason here our client was very worried about that all the campaigns suddenly increased.
A sudden CPC increase on Facebook Ads can happen due to higher competition in the same audience, seasonal demand (like Q4 or holiday traffic), or ad fatigue - when your audience has seen the same creatives too often. Also, Meta’s algorithm can shift bidding behavior after updates or budget changes. Try refreshing creatives, checking audience overlap, and reviewing bid strategy and placements.

Facebook Ads CPC Increase
What is the reason here our client was very worried about that all the campaigns suddenly increased.
The CPC boost variation is often not just a single service campaign, but a market-wide effect.
Facebook works on an auction mechanism — when many advertisers compete for the same users, prices naturally increase.
Customers are worried because they see increased costs without corresponding results, but this is a normal trend during high competition periods (like Q4 or peak season).
